A Crowd at the Mineral block....... Usually each whitetail takes its turn at the block, a status order, however today the doe and fawns are all in the pit together. Doe is licking nose with tongue, after licking block, also look at the spots along the backbone of the nearest fawn, I guess the last spots to disappear.
Classic Whitetail in the Fall....The does are looking good this time of year, eating a lot of acorns, high in fats and protein . The herd size seems to be increasing in number, I assume because of the onset of winter and the rut.

VELVET SHEDDING AT LAST....
About 2 days ago this buck just began to shed velvet , usually that occurs 3 rd. week of August. Time and date on camera incorrect. Bodies are filling out nicely, good acorn crop.

Whitetail antler growth (GOOD) It seems the bucks, at least, in my area will have good racks this year. I would like to think it is from the new mineral block, however the heavy rains in the spring, made for lush foliage ( IE. A super food supply). About the 15 to 25 of August the velvet will be shed. Antlers will be polished for about a month to 6 weeks,they start putting on fat for winter and the rut( acorns & other nuts) Rut usually starts around November 8-12. I think all the photos are of 4 different bucks

Whitetail ( angle- rack) just started to photograph around the clock because have had very few visual sightings recently. I like to find some visual identity to follow each deer up into the rutting season. This one has angular growth pattern of the antlers. I will now start to plot the frequency at the block to the estimated distant of travel. ie, if he is at the block two times a day I will assume the travel is an estimated range of only several miles. If I see him only once a week the range would be considerable more.
